Responsibilities
Elevating Banquet Operations: Support the daily management of banquet operations, ensuring seamless execution of events that embody The Ritz-Carlton Gold Standards.
Oversee the setup, service, and breakdown of events with an eye for detail and refinement.
Maintain departmental inventories, equipment, and supplies to the highest level of readiness.
Assist in monitoring labor scheduling and costs while protecting the integrity of service excellence.
Leading & Inspiring Ladies and Gentlemen: Guide and support banquet captains and service teams, ensuring they embody The Ritz-Carlton philosophy of service.
Lead pre-event briefings, instilling confidence and clarity among the team.
Participate in the recruitment, onboarding, and development of banquet talent.
Provide coaching and feedback, fostering a culture of continuous growth and excellence.
Creating Memorable Guest Experiences: Serve as a gracious and professional liaison for meeting planners and hosts, anticipating and exceeding their needs.
Address guest concerns promptly and with genuine care, turning challenges into opportunities to delight.
Collaborate with culinary and beverage teams to ensure flawless coordination and delivery.
Champion guest satisfaction through thoughtful interactions and consistent service excellence.
Administrative & Leadership Responsibilities: Maintain accurate employee records, including scheduling, attendance, and payroll.
Conduct regular team meetings to share goals, celebrate achievements, and align on upcoming priorities.
Support the implementation of service improvement plans based on guest feedback and performance metrics.
Ensure compliance with safety, sanitation, and brand standards at all times.
